About KRG Kite Realty Group Trust

Kite Realty Group Trust specializing in high-quality, open-air shopping centers and mixed-use assets. Concentrated in the Sun Belt and strategic gateway markets, the company focuses on grocery-anchored, necessity-based retail. The company generates the majority of its revenue from contractual rents and reimbursement payments received from tenants.

About CE Celanese Corporation

Celanese is one of the world's largest producers of acetic acid and its downstream derivative chemicals, which are used in various end markets, including coatings and adhesives. The company is also one of the largest producers of specialty polymers, which are used in the automotive, electronics, medical, building, and consumer end markets. The company also makes cellulose derivatives used in cigarette filters.
